Latest Patents
John L Nard holds a patent for an "Augmented Reality Guided Inspection." This invention provides a method, computer system, and computer program product for augmented reality guidance. The technology allows device orientation instructions to be displayed as augmented reality on a device's screen. The device, which may include a camera and be portable, can show a view of an object. Users receive additional instructions that direct their interaction with the object, enhancing the overall experience. The camera captures images of the object, which are then processed by a machine learning model to generate outputs displayed on the screen.
